Living in Fawn … WebPS:The Daily levy rate exclusively applies to Work Permit Holders, who did not work for a full calendar month. The daily levy rate = (Monthly levy rate x 12) / 365 (rounded up to the nearest cent. WebIt depends on when you pay the CPF contribution for each employee. Dependency Ratio Ceiling. Dependency Ratio Ceiling (DRC) refers to the maximum permitted ratio of foreign workers to the total workforce that a company in the stipulated sector is allowed to hire. ... WebYou have to pay Skills Development Levy (SDL) for all your employees working in Singapore, including: • employees employed on permanent, part-time, casual and temporary basis • foreign employees on work permits and employment pass holders SDL is payable to the SkillsFuture Singapore Agency (SSG) for foreign employees.

WebMOM determines the foreign worker quota for a company based on the CPF account of the company. The contribution made by the employer indicates the local workforce employed in the business activity. ...
